Right, published administrative contact addresses (particularly abuse@ and postmaster@) should have **no content filtering**.

This is one of the more annoying things I run into when trying to be a good netizen, particularly when the domain gets all its email via Google.



I have updated Postfix to not filter admin contacts so here comes the spam. :) I already had some local rules to subtract some points for these recipients in SA to make the blocking score 10.0 instead of the 6.0 default in MailScanner.
